HOW TO SAY “I DON’T UNDERSTAND” IN FRENCH
I dont understand in French is:
So, here we have the verb comprendre (to understand) conjugated in the present tense and the negation ne…pas that goes around the conjugated verb. If you need a refresher on negation, listen to episode 36 and episode 146 of the French Made Easy podcast.
